Hi

I was wondering if there is any way of finding out the offset on a set of wheels, I have an 97 VX Omega with 17" Wolfrace icon alloys and i want to fit them on my scooby but I am not sure of the offset of the wheels or the offet I need for the scooby, I have had a look on the wheels but I can't find anything, the is one part that says "ET" but no number after,

Any idea's?

You need to take a measurment from the centre line of the wheel to the mounting face, ie the distance between the two, this is the offset.
I realy dont think there is much chance of the Vauxhall wheels fiting any rate, IIRC the PCD (bolt circle) on Vaux wheels are 110 where as the Impreza uses 100 PCD, OR vice versa!
The offset used is normaly between 48 and 52mm or there abouts.
